Ingredients You’ll Need
Gathering the ingredients for Roasted Carrots with Whipped Ricotta and Hot Honey is as simple as can be! These wholesome components come together to create a dish that feels both comforting and sophisticated.
For the Roasted Carrots:
- 1½ lbs (about 6–8 medium) carrots, peeled and halved lengthwise
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¼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
- ½ teaspoon smoked paprika (optional, for extra depth)
For the Whipped Ricotta:
- 1 cup whole-milk ricotta cheese
- 2 tablespoons heavy cream or milk
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- Zest of 1 lemon
- Salt and pepper to taste
For the Hot Honey:
- ¼ cup honey
- ½ teaspoon red pepper flakes (adjust to taste)
- 1 teaspoon apple cider vinegar
Optional Garnishes:
- Chopped fresh parsley or chives
- Crushed pistachios or walnuts
- Flaky sea salt
- Lemon zest

How to Make Roasted Carrots with Whipped Ricotta and Hot Honey
Step 1: Roast the Carrots
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a large baking sheet with parchment paper. This little step makes cleanup so much easier! Toss the peeled and halved carrots with olive oil, salt, pepper, and optional smoked paprika. Spread them cut-side down on the baking sheet—this helps achieve those beautiful caramelized edges. Roast for about 25–30 minutes until tender; flipping halfway ensures even cooking.
Step 2: Prepare the Whipped Ricotta
While your carrots are roasting away, it’s time to whip up that creamy ricotta! In a food processor or blender, combine the ricotta, cream (or milk), olive oil, and lemon zest. Blend everything together until smooth and fluffy—this adds such wonderful texture. Don’t forget to taste it! A pinch of salt and pepper will elevate those flavors even more.
Step 3: Make the Hot Honey
In a small saucepan over low heat, warm your honey gently—not too hot! Add in red pepper flakes for that kick we love. Let it simmer just enough for about 3–4 minutes before adding apple cider vinegar; this balances out the sweetness beautifully. Remove from heat once done—it will thicken as it cools.
Step 4: Assemble the Dish
Now comes the fun part! Spread a generous layer of whipped ricotta on your serving platter or individual plates. Arrange those warm roasted carrots lovingly over the top—don’t be shy here! Drizzle that luscious hot honey all over. Finish off with your choice of garnishes like fresh herbs or nuts if you’d like some crunch. Serve immediately while everything is warm; it’s best enjoyed straight from the oven!
Pro Tips for Making Roasted Carrots with Whipped Ricotta and Hot Honey
To ensure your roasted carrots are absolutely perfect, keep these tips in mind!
- Choose the right carrots: Look for firm, vibrant carrots without blemishes. Fresh, high-quality carrots will have better flavor and texture.
- Don’t overcrowd the baking sheet: Giving each carrot enough space allows them to roast rather than steam, resulting in a lovely caramelization.
- Experiment with spices: Feel free to add your favorite herbs or spices to the carrot mixture before roasting. This can enhance the flavors and give your dish a personal twist.
- Adjust the heat level: If you prefer a milder flavor, reduce the amount of red pepper flakes in the hot honey. Conversely, if you love heat, feel free to add more!
- Serve immediately: For the best experience, serve this dish right after assembling. The contrast of warm carrots and cool whipped ricotta is delightful.

Make Ahead and Storage
This recipe is perfect for meal prep, allowing you to enjoy delicious roasted carrots throughout the week. The components can be made in advance, making it easy to serve as a side dish or a light meal.
Storing Leftovers
- Allow the roasted carrots to cool completely before storing.
- Place them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- Store whipped ricotta separately in an airtight container; it will keep for about 2 days.
Freezing
- Roasted carrots can be frozen, but they may lose some texture.
- Spread the cooled carrots on a baking sheet and freeze until solid,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ag or container.
- Whipped ricotta does not freeze well; it’s best enjoyed fresh.
Reheating
- To reheat roasted carrots, place them on a baking sheet and warm in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es.
- You can also microwave individual portions for about 1-2 minutes, adding a splash of water to keep them moist.
FAQs
Can I use other vegetables instead of carrots in this recipe?
Absolutely! While this recipe focuses on roasted carrots with whipped ricotta and hot honey, you can substitute with other root vegetables like parsnips or sweet potatoes. Just adjust the roasting time as needed.
How do I make whipped ricotta for Roasted Carrots with Whipped Ricotta and Hot Honey?
Making whipped ricotta is simple! Blend ricotta cheese with heavy cream (or milk), olive oil, lemon zest, salt, and pepper until smooth and fluffy. This creamy topping perfectly complements the sweet roasted carrots.
What is hot honey, and how can I make it?
Hot honey is honey infused with chili flakes for a sweet and spicy kick. To make it at home, gently warm honey and stir in red pepper flakes. Let it steep for a few minutes before using.
